Demonstrators, numbering around a thousand, unfurled a massive Ukrainian flag measuring 52×33 meters and weighing 150 kilograms.
Rally Highlights
-
Location and Purpose
- The event took place in Presidential Park near the White House.
- Organized under the banner “Don’t Abandon Ukraine”, the rally aimed to underscore the importance of sustained U.S. backing.
-
Diverse Participation
- Alongside Ukrainian Americans, participants included Poles, representatives from Eastern European communities, and Americans concerned about global security.
- Demonstrators held signs with slogans like “Support Ukraine”, “Russia is a terrorist state”, and “Make Russia pay.”
-
Monumental Ukrainian Flag
- A highlight of the protest was the massive Ukrainian flag – 52×33 meters – waved above the crowd.
- Weighing 150 kg, the flag’s presence served as a powerful statement of solidarity and visibility.
